The third largest coal ash spill in United States history has left some citizens in North Carolina fearing their water is not safe to drink. This fear is a result of anywhere between 50,000 and 82,000 tons of coal ash and up to twenty-seven million gallons of contaminated water being dumped into the Dan River in Eden, North Carolina on February 2, 2014. The spill was caused by a busted storm drain pipe that ran under an unlined coal ash pond at Duke Energyââ¬â¢s Dan River Combined Cycle Station (ââ¬Å"Duke Energyââ¬â¢s Grievousâ⬠). Coal ash is a byproduct of burning coal for energy and contains substances such as arsenic, lead, and mercury. The armed conflict in Syria is the largest humanitarian crisis facing the world at the moment. This encounter is between rebel fighters opposed to President Bashar al Assad rule and forces loyal to him. Around 100,000 Syrians have died since the uprising began (Lederer). However, the world is yet to come with a clear plan on how to end these atrocities. The disagreement between major powers should be blamed on this failure. For instance, Russia and the US have differed on almost every proposal aimed at bringing peace in Syria. Unless a compromise is reached, a quick solution to the catastrophe will not be reached. Syriaââ¬â¢s conflict is a serious threat to the regionââ¬â¢s stability. There is a high probability that this conflict may spill-over to neighboring countries. An especially disturbing issue is that the unrest may create new breeding grounds for Al-Qaeda and other extremist organization. Due to conflicting interests, the Syrian issue can make or break the world. If not checked, this crisis can instigate a world war or another cold war. However, nobody intends to go that road. Under the international law, when a situation takes a humanitarian angle, focus shifts from a stateââ¬â¢s right to stateââ¬â¢s obligation towards its citizens. Sovereignty is derived from people and, therefore, their rights, interest and security should be prioritized. The US will be justified to strike Syria if use of chemical weapons against innocent civilians continues. Under the US constitution, the president can unilaterally sanction a military intervention when there is an actual or an impending threat to the county (Fox). According to Jay Carney, the White House spokesman, president Obama has the authority to strike Syria (Lewis). War Powers Resolution of 1973, gives the president the right to sanction limited military intervention (Fox). Therefore, Congressââ¬â¢ input on whether the US should strike Syria may be required, but it is not legally enforced. The war powers act is, thus, unclear on whether president Obama requires a vote from congress to continue with his plans on Syria. How Red Bull Got Started Red Bull first came to the market in 1987à after Austrian toothpaste salesman Dietrich Mateschitz came to Thailand and heard about an ââ¬Å"energy tonicâ⬠, created by Chaleo Yoovidhya. The tonic was supposed to help keep drinkers awake and alert. After three years of testing Red Bull launched in Austria, but the two businessmen had doubters. ââ¬Å"There is no demand in the market for this type of drink,â⬠they said. There was no way anyone would go for it. They were wrong. Today, Red Bull dominates, with over 43% of the market share in 2015. The best part? Theyââ¬â¢re still going strong. Considering Red Bull created the market in the first place, dominating just about half of it after nearly three decades years isnââ¬â¢t bad. Check out this infographic of their whole history: The History Of Red Bull's Unconventional Marketing Strategy When Red Bull first came out, energy drinks didnââ¬â¢t exist, and traditional advertising was expensive. So, Red Bull went rogue and went with a different strategy. What did they do, exactly? They simply went straight to their target audience (18 -35-year-old males)at college parties, libraries, coffee shops, bars and other places where they hang out. By bringing their audience free samples, they put the product right in their consumer's hands. That got their audience talking, spreading the word about their product for free. Revamping the Way They Use Traditional Media Itââ¬â¢s not just content marketing that Red Bull dominates. The brand invests a substantial amount in traditional mass media channels as well. Red Bullââ¬â¢s TV content operates in two formats: videos they create for their online channelsà (YouTube, social media, etc.)à and ads that they partner with traditional TV channel content: Their TV content resides on their online hub called Red Bull TV. Their videos and shows are segmented into formats like Events and Films as well as channel topics like Cliff Diving and Culture: Theyââ¬â¢ve moved into the music realm too. In addition to covering or sponsoring massive musical festivals, Red Bull also boasts itââ¬â¢s own record label, recording studio, music academy, publishing group, and online radio station. What are the key topics in macroeconomics? The key topics in macroeconomics are growth, business cycles, unemployment and inflation. 5. Describe fiscal, monetary, and structural policy. Fiscal policy is regarding changes in government spending or taxes, to make more active or slow down economy. Monetary policy helps influence the economy by initiating changes in the banking systemââ¬â¢s reserves that would affect money supply and credit availability in the economy. Structural policy on the other hand focuses in general on economic productivity and growth. 6. Describe the factors that will affect demand and supply (in other words, what factors will shift the supply and demand curves). Factors such as income, prices of other goods, tastes and expectations are factors affecting demand. Those factors affecting supply are prices of inputs, technology, taxes and subsidies and expectations. Factors affecting demand are mostly those that consumers are looking forward prior to their purc hase. Factors affecting supply are in general would affect the creation of certain product or service offerings. 7. a. Explain thoroughly what the supply and demand curves represent. The supply curve is a representation of the relationship between price and quantity supplied while the demand curve represents the relationship between price and quantity demanded. Assuming everything is constant; supply curve will have the slope upward to the right. So, the quantity supplied should increase in response to the rise in price, in the absence of shift factors. Assuming other things constant, the demand curve slopes downward to the right, which means the rise of price makes the quantity demanded goes down. b. Draw a supply and demand curve for petroleum.
